Transaction 81ef09b27e996a4b246d4649c99f06baef02c365acd9a8a8f0f9761c24a8cf0e
1 Input
1 Output
-
81ef09b27e996a4b246d4649c99f06baef02c365acd9a8a8f0f9761c24a8cf0e:0
- value
- 375659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ebefa6b7ed16cdd26e4f437ecef0259289adeed OP_EQUAL
- address
- 3Bnb33TmG5NXx7PQyzwWjvh5PQPyqCU7cd